Cheap Christmas Gift Ideas

 Christmas is the season of giving, and buying a gift is a great way to show someone how much you care. However, we all have long lists of people to buy gifts for, from family members to co-workers to teachers to the mailman. Luckily, there are many cheap Christmas gift ideas that will still make your recipient feel special and appreciated.

Personalized mugs

Personalized mugs are a great way to express your gratitude for someone. These gifts are perfect for any occasion, from Christmas to Mother's Day. You can customize the mug with a photo or a saying. Personalized gifts are more memorable, and are a unique way to show your appreciation. Mass-produced gifts can lose their originality and feel cliche. Personalized gifts add a personal touch, as well as excitement and sentimental value.

You can also choose from a variety of designs and colors. For example, you can get a coffee mug that is decorated with Christmas trees. Stationery

When shopping for stationery gifts for your loved ones, consider choosing stationery that is personalized. These gifts are sure to be appreciated. Pens and notebooks are versatile and always appreciated. These gifts are also a great option if you are buying for a stranger. Many people use notebooks for multiple purposes, from making lists to jotting down notes.

A nice notebook is essential for keeping track of tasks, but you don't have to spend a fortune on it. You can find inexpensive notebooks from a variety of online retailers. You can also buy a set of notebooks from a stationery subscription service like Papergang. This service offers one-month, three-month, and twelve-month subscriptions of unique stationery items.

Personalized candles

Personalized candles are a great way to commemorate a special occasion and add a sweet fragrance to the house. They also draw attention to favorite family memories. They come in a wide range of design colors and collections and can be placed in glass or ceramic candle holders to match the decor of a room. Popular candle colors include white and red.

The price of these gifts can range from a few dollars to hundreds, depending on how personalized they are. You can customize a candle with personalized labels and notes or even place jewelry in them. Many brands offer customizing options and Etsy has tons of sellers. Personalized candles are especially nice to give as gifts during the holiday season.
